Several factors help determine whether AC repair makes sense or if replacement is the better option. Age plays a big role – systems over 10-15 years old with major component failures often benefit from replacement. Frequent repairs, rising energy bills, and poor cooling performance despite maintenance are also signs replacement might be more cost-effective. Our technician will assess your system’s condition, explain repair costs versus replacement benefits, and help you understand the long-term value of each option without pressure to choose the more expensive route.
Garfield’s hot, humid summers create specific challenges for AC systems. The most common issues include frozen evaporator coils caused by restricted airflow from dirty filters, refrigerant leaks that reduce cooling capacity, and capacitor failures that prevent the system from starting. Clogged condensate drains are also frequent due to high humidity levels, causing water backup and potential system shutdown. Overworked compressors can fail during extended heat waves when systems run continuously. Regular maintenance helps prevent many of these issues, but when problems occur, quick professional repair prevents minor issues from becoming major failures.
